Alex Forrest (Winnipeg, MB) lost 4-3 to William Lyburn (Winnipeg, MB) in the Final of the MCT Championships, held December 11 - 13, 2015 in Dauphin, Manitoba. To advance to the championship game, Forrest won 6-1 over David Bohn (Winnipeg, MB) in the semifinals of the 2015 MCT Championships in Dauphin, Manitoba; and won 7-5 over Richard Muntain (Pinawa, MB) in the quarterfinals. of the 2015 MCT Championships in Dauphin, Manitoba;
 
Forrest finished 2-2 in the 14-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Forrest lost 7-3 to Lyburn, droppimg another game, 5-3 to Jared Kolomaya (Stonewall, MB) where Forrest responded with a 7-2 win over Curtis McCannell (Pilot Mound, MB). Forrest won 7-1 against Daley Peters (Winnipeg, MB) in their final qualifying round match.
 
With their runner-up finish at the MCT Championships, Forrest take home 17.712 world rankings points along with the $2,000CDN prize, moving up 6 spots the World Ranking Standings into 28th place overall with 133.569 total points. Forrest ranks 39th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 74.612 points earned so far this season.
